The question compares the dose of intra-dermal fractional Inactivated Polio Vaccine (fIPV) with the standard intramuscular (I/M) IPV dose.
The standard I/M dose of IPV is 0.5 mL. The fractional intra-dermal dose (fIPV) used in immunization programs is 0.1 mL, administered intra-dermally rather than intramuscularly. This intra-dermal route allows a smaller antigen dose to still generate adequate immunogenicity because the dermis is rich in antigen-presenting (Langerhans) cells.
Calculating the ratio: 0.1 mL / 0.5 mL = 1/5. Hence, fIPV is one-fifth of the standard I/M IPV dose, not three-fourths, half, or one-tenth.
Therefore, the correct answer is that fIPV is one-fifth of the I/M dose of IPV.
